Company Overview

Upchurch is a rapidly growing, full-service building engineering company providing mechanical, plumbing, HVAC, and electrical services across the southeastern United States. Founded in 1970 and headquartered in Horn Lake, MS, Upchurch has grown through both organic expansion and strategic acquisitions, establishing a strong reputation for quality, reliability, and service excellence. We offer end-to-end solutions—from design and installation to ongoing maintenance and emergency support—helping clients maximize building performance, energy efficiency, and equipment lifespan.

Position Summary

We are seeking a proactive and detail-oriented Safety Coordinator to support our safety initiatives across project and service operations. Based in Arlington, TX with responsibilities throughout the DFW region, this role works closely with local and corporate safety teams to ensure regulatory compliance, facilitate training, support inspections, and help foster a strong, proactive safety culture.

Key Responsibilities

As a Safety Coordinator, you will support and advance the company's safety initiatives through the following responsibilities (including but not limited to):

  • Implement and Enforce Safety Programs: Assist in applying and upholding company safety policies and procedures across all job sites, ensuring a proactive and consistent safety approach.
  • Maintain and Facilitate Orientation: Deliver new-hire orientation.
  • Conduct Inspections and Audits: Perform regular site safety inspections and audits; document findings, identify hazards, and verify timely corrective actions.
  • Training and Awareness: Coordinate and track safety training for employees and subcontractors. Promote knowledge of emergency procedures, proper PPE usage, and site-specific safety protocols.
  • Facilitate Toolbox Talks and Safety Meetings: Support leaders with toolbox talk and safety meeting material and facilitation.
  • Maintain Necessary Levels of PPE: Maintain PPE in the office to support field operations.
  • Ensure Regulatory Compliance: Support compliance with OSHA and other applicable federal, state, and local safety regulations. Stay informed of regulatory changes and industry best practices.
  • Incident Response and Reporting: Assist in incident investigations and root cause analyses. Maintain accurate records of incidents, corrective actions, and ongoing safety measures.
  • Collaboration and Engagement: Partner with field teams, site management, and corporate safety personnel to champion safety initiatives. Actively participate in safety meetings and promote a culture of safety awareness.
  • Maintain Safety Documentation: Ensure all safety records—including inspections, training logs, and incident reports—are accurate, organized, and audit-ready.
  • Drive Continuous Improvement: Analyze safety trends and suggest performance improvements. Research and propose tools, technologies, and best practices that enhance safety outcomes.
  • Other duties as assigned.

Qualifications

  • OSHA 30-hour certification or equivalent safety training (required)
  • Minimum of 3 years of experience in construction, industrial, or service environments
  • 5 years in a dedicated safety role (minimum 3 years in the construction/heavy service industry)
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office, digital safety management systems, and AI
  • Safety-related education (degree, certification, or relevant coursework — varies)

Personal Attributes

  • Strong organizational skills and attention to detail
  • Excellent communicator with a team-oriented mindset
  • Self-motivated and capable of making sound decisions under pressure
  • Committed to promoting and maintaining a proactive safety culture

Physical Requirements

  • Ability to walk and inspect projects and job sites in various weather and ground conditions
  • Capable of lifting and carrying up to 30 lbs as needed for safety inspections or equipment
  • Able to climb stairs, ladders, and navigate uneven terrain during site walkthroughs
